Mum and three children burnt to death in Kwale

Four family members were on Friday night burnt to death after their house was razed by a fire at Taru in Kinango subcounty. The fire claimed the lives of a mother and her three children. Kwale police confirmed the incident. According to the report released by police on Saturday, the four family members were identified as Samia Kikoi, 32, Husnein Hussein, 10, Mulhat Hussein, 6, and Ilham Hussein, 1. Police who rushed to the scene could not immediately establish the cause of the fire. However, locals believe a candle might have caused the fire. The father had gone to watch a football match. “The family might have left the candle burning causing havoc,” said Ali Ruwa, a local. NHIF to cut benefits in cost saving plan

Renal dialysis, major surgeries and diagnostics tests such as MRI and CT-scans top the list of benefits that the National Hospital Insurance Fund (NHIF) aims to cut in a drive to reduce payouts. The State-backed insurer’s cost-cutting drive will reduce payouts to hospitals by at least Sh2.9 billion in the year to June 2022, forcing thousands of beneficiaries to top-up for their medical bills. The maximum cover for MRI scan will be reduced to Sh9,600 from the current Sh15,000 per session while settlement of CT-scans is set to be capped at Sh6,000 from Sh8,000. Uganda opens places of worship, keeps schools shut

Ugandan President Yoweri Museveni on Wednesday ordered the reopening of worship centres, but with strict adherence to Covid-19 protocols to avoid further spread of the coronavirus. “Places of worship can now open under strict guidelines like, limiting the number to 200 people and adhering to all other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s )in place,” he said. The number of people attending weddings and other social events was also increased to 200, while casinos, gaming, betting shops, and gyms were allowed to operate during the day and close by 6pm.  Mr Museveni also allowed weekly and monthly markets to open with strict adherence to Covid-19 protocols. Mother and Son Reunite after 58 Years Apart

Speaking to BBC, Calvin Barrett said growing up without a mother was tough, and he longed for the day they would be reunited. Barrett last saw his mother when six, and their grandparents raised him and his brother. The 64-year old from the US searched for his 85-year-old mother, Molly Payne, from the UK for almost 40 years. After Barrett's daughter did an ancestry DNA test that matched with Payne's nephew, they were finally reunited. Payne met Barrett's dad while he was in the American army base in the UK, and they got married in 1955. After that, they moved to the US, but she returned to the UK two years later. Ronaldo Scammed KSh 37 million by Travel Agent.

Manchester United striker Cristiano Ronaldo was scammed a staggering KSh 37 million (£250,000) by a female travel agent after he trusted her with his credit card pin, SunSport reports. The culprit was 53-year-old Maria Silva, as reports further claim she also scammed the player’s agent Jorge Mendes out of over £14,000 (KSh 2.1 million) as well as more than £1,500 (KSh 226,000) from former Man Utd winger Nani. According to famous Portuguese outlet Jornal de Noticias, Maria Silva’s offence saw her handed a four-year suspended prison after being convicted in a 2017 sentence at a court in Porto. Sigalame High School in Busia closed after fourth fire incident.

Sigalame High School in Funyula, Busia County, has been closed indefinitely after a fire razed one of the dormitories on Monday night. This becomes the fourth fire incident in the school since it was reopened this term. Samia sub-county Director of Education Dominic Opee said the students will remain home until investigations into the cause of the fire are concluded. The learners early Tuesday morning caused a fracas when they chased away the school guards, injuring one of them in the process. Police officers have however since restored order in the institution.

Man killed in Bomet as drinking spree turns tragic.

A man was been killed after a drinking spree turned soar in Longisa trading centre in Kamagut. Peter Ekai 30, and Elphas Kipkoech 26, were on a drinking spree at  Kamagut before they started arguing about their jobs. DCI boss George Kinoti said Ekai turned to his friend Kipkoech and accused him of plotting for his downfall, at a local security agency where he worked as a guard. "He reportedly told Kipkoech that he had reliably learnt that he wanted him sacked, so that he could replace him at ChapChap security agency," Kinoti said. Kinoti said a bitter argument then ensued between the two who were already drunk, with Kipkoech denying the allegations.
